数据库靠什么统计数据的
-
数据库通过以下几种方式来统计数据:
-
SQL查询语言:数据库使用结构化查询语言(SQL)来执行查询和统计操作。SQL提供了各种命令和函数,可以从数据库中检索、过滤、排序和聚合数据。通过编写适当的SQL查询,可以根据特定的条件和要求统计数据。
-
聚合函数:数据库提供了各种聚合函数,如SUM、COUNT、AVG等。这些函数可以对数据进行求和、计数、平均等操作,从而实现对数据的统计分析。
-
视图:数据库可以创建视图来存储特定的查询结果。视图是虚拟的表,可以将其视为预定义的查询。通过创建适当的视图,可以将数据按照特定的条件进行分类和汇总,从而方便统计数据。
-
存储过程:数据库可以创建存储过程来执行特定的数据统计操作。存储过程是一组预定义的SQL语句,可以在数据库中进行存储和重复使用。通过编写适当的存储过程,可以实现复杂的数据统计逻辑。
-
数据分析工具:除了数据库本身的功能之外,还可以使用各种数据分析工具来统计数据库中的数据。这些工具提供了更高级的统计功能,如数据可视化、数据挖掘、统计建模等。通过使用这些工具,可以更方便地进行数据统计和分析。
总之,数据库通过SQL查询语言、聚合函数、视图、存储过程和数据分析工具等方式来统计数据,以满足用户对数据的统计需求。这些方法可以根据具体的业务需求和数据分析要求进行灵活的组合和应用。
1年前 -
-
数据库通过使用各种统计方法和算法来统计数据。具体来说,数据库可以通过以下几种方式来统计数据:
-
聚合函数:数据库提供了一系列的聚合函数,如SUM、COUNT、AVG、MAX、MIN等。通过使用这些函数,可以对数据进行求和、计数、平均值、最大值、最小值等统计操作。
-
分组操作:数据库可以使用GROUP BY语句将数据按照指定的列进行分组,然后对每个组进行统计。通过分组操作,可以统计每个组的数量、总和、平均值等。
-
过滤条件:数据库可以根据特定的条件来过滤数据,然后统计满足条件的数据的数量或其他统计信息。通过设置合适的过滤条件,可以实现更精确的数据统计。
-
数据透视表:数据透视表是一种特殊的数据统计工具,可以将数据按照多个维度进行汇总和统计。数据库可以使用透视表功能来生成透视表,以实现更复杂的数据统计需求。
-
统计函数和算法:除了常用的聚合函数外,数据库还提供了一些特殊的统计函数和算法,如标准差、方差、百分位数等。这些函数和算法可以用于更深入的数据分析和统计。
总之,数据库通过聚合函数、分组操作、过滤条件、数据透视表以及统计函数和算法等多种方式来实现数据的统计。根据具体的需求和数据特点,可以选择合适的统计方法来获取所需的统计结果。
1年前 -
-
数据库统计数据是通过使用查询语言和统计函数来完成的。数据库系统提供了一些内置的统计函数和聚合函数,可以用来计算、分析和汇总数据。
下面是一些常见的统计函数和操作流程:
-
COUNT函数:用于计算某个列中的行数。可以用来统计某个表中的记录数,或者在查询中统计满足特定条件的记录数。
-
SUM函数:用于计算某个列的总和。可以用来统计某个表中数值列的总和,如销售额、利润等。
-
AVG函数:用于计算某个列的平均值。可以用来统计某个表中数值列的平均值,如平均销售额、平均利润等。
-
MAX和MIN函数:分别用于计算某个列的最大值和最小值。可以用来统计某个表中数值列的最大值和最小值,如最高销售额、最低利润等。
-
GROUP BY子句:用于按照指定的列对结果进行分组。可以将数据按照某个列的值进行分组,然后对每个分组进行统计操作,如计算每个地区的销售总额。
-
HAVING子句:用于对分组后的结果进行条件过滤。可以根据指定的条件过滤分组后的结果,如只显示销售总额大于10000的地区。
-
DISTINCT关键字:用于去除结果中的重复行。可以对结果进行去重操作,保证每个行只出现一次。
-
ORDER BY子句:用于对结果进行排序。可以根据指定的列对结果进行升序或降序排序,如按照销售额从高到低排序。
-
使用子查询:可以使用子查询来进行数据的嵌套查询和统计。可以在查询中嵌套使用子查询,将结果作为另一个查询的条件或者统计对象。
以上是一些常见的统计函数和操作流程,通过灵活组合和使用这些函数和语句,可以对数据库中的数据进行全面的统计和分析。
1年前 -